On the search page in Mnemo there are two options, one to search the 
first line of the text  and the other to search the full text. These 
options are currently check boxes, meaning a users can select to 
search both (redundant) or neither (useless). The attached patch 
changes these check boxes to radio buttons so that only one option or 
the other can be selected at a time.
